Transaction ed43a828f7dbff2996bbc2353b59a97d0d07d7e94d3cfefc02b517519bc96abf

3 Input
1 Outputs
  • ed43a828f7dbff2996bbc2353b59a97d0d07d7e94d3cfefc02b517519bc96abf:0
  • value  7076905
    address  1BYZWPAeZq9dAQLQ1B42g2kad8CdU2Wo24